WebFeb 24, 2024 · Mealworms should not make up more than 10% of their total diet. Here are some tips for feeding mealworms to your budgie: Live or Dried. Mealworms can be fed to budgies either live or dried. Live mealworms should be offered in a dish, while dried mealworms can be sprinkled on top of their food or offered in a separate dish.
